Mmmm ... breakfast. What could sound better than a cigarette and a croissant? Well, maybe in France. German photographer Oliver Schwarzwald documented traditional breakfasts all over the world, taking out all the cups, plates and other containers and making the food itself into art.

The all-American breakfast of OJ, cornflakes with milk and a pancake with berries and syrup.
A Russian delicacy of caviar on toast, a hard-boiled egg and ... is that vodka we spot?
